Users enrolled in SSRPM are provided with a “Forgot my password…” link at the bottom of their HelloID or Active Directory login prompt. When users click on this link, they are enabled to:
- Enroll
- Reset a forgotten password
- Change their password
- Update basic Active Directory user info (e.g., contact information)
- Proceed with their onboarding

You may add your own, but SSRPM’s default security questions include:
In what city did you meet your spouse/significant other?
What was your childhood nickname?
What is the name of your favorite childhood friend?
What street did you live on in third grade?
What is your oldest sibling’s birthday month and year? (e.g., January 1900)
What is the middle name of your youngest child?
What is your oldest sibling’s middle name?
What school did you attend for sixth grade?
What was your childhood phone number including area code? (e.g., 000-000-0000)
What was the name of your first stuffed animal?
In what city or town did your mother and father meet?
What was the last name of your third grade teacher?
What is the first name of the boy or girl that you first kissed?
What is your maternal grandmother’s maiden name?
In what town was your first job?
For education/youth users, the following security questions are more applicable:
Who wrote your favorite book?
Who is the best superhero (or villain)?
What is the name of your first-grade teacher?
What is your favorite sports team?
What is the name of the scientist you admire?
What is your favorite outdoor activity?
If you could be any animal, what would you be?
Simply put, “onboarding” refers to the process of getting a new hire up to speed on organizational processes, policies, and with provisioned access to the necessary resources required for their job’s responsibilities. Successful onboarding aims to help new employees quickly become effective within the organization.
Tools4ever’s solutions optimize the business and IT side of onboarding processes that ensure new users’ access to network resources like accounts, applications, and file shares. Above all, SSRPM’s Onboarding module helps ensure the safe transfer of user accounts and passwords to new employees.
